Yo-El Ju, MD

Barbara Burton and Reuben Morriss III Professor of Neurology

Dr. Ju is a leader in the study of human sleep in a variety of neurodegenerative diseases, including Alzheimer and Parkinson Disease. Her research expertise includes human polysomnography, actigraphy, blood and cerebrospinal fluid biomarkers, and manipulation of sleep. She is also a neurologist with clinical expertise in Sleep Medicine, and see patients in the Washington University Sleep Center. Dr. Ju leads the COBRAS human core, and provides expertise in human sleep studies, biomarkers, actigraphy, and humans circadian rhythm analysis.
